NEW TESTPOINT SOFTWARE INTEGRATES IEEE-488 INSTRUMENTS WITH DATA
ACQUISITION HARDWARE

CLEVELAND, OHIO -- February 17, 1994 -- Keithley Instruments, Inc. has
introduced TestPoint, a multi-tasking, object-oriented software package
designed to simplify creating custom test, measurement and data
acquisition applications in the Microsoft Windows environment without the
need for conventional programming techniques. In addition to support for a
wide array of hardware, the package makes it easy to create custom user
interfaces, develop test routines, process and display data, create report
files, and exchange information with other Windows applications such as
popular spreadsheet and wordprocessing packages via Dynamic Data Exchange
(DDE).

TestPoint combines IEEE-488, RS-232, and RS-485 instrument control
capabilities with support for a broad range of data acquisition hardware.
While most application development packages support either test and
measurement instruments or data acquisition boards but not both, TestPoint
allows users to combine instruments and boards in a single application.
The package provides Dynamic Link Libraries (DLLs) that make it easy to
control more than 70 popular test and measurement instruments, including
Keithley's Model 2001 Digital Multimeter and the Model 182 Sensitive
Digital Voltmeter. DLL support is also included for Keithley's KPC-488.2
IEEE cards and data acquisition boards, including the Keithley MetraByte
DAS-1600, DAS-1200, DAS-800, and DAS-TC boards.

TestPoint's application development screen has four parts. The stock window
holds icons for both standard and user-defined objects such as displays,
graphs, switches and interface hardware. The object panel identifies the
major components of the application and often includes GPIB devices, user
input fields, graphs, data files, and math formulas. This is where stock
objects take on custom information for use in the application. The display
panel represents the user interface for the application. The action list
is a sequence of actions to be executed when an object receives an event
or instruction.

Unlike competitive packages, TestPoint makes it easy to create
sophisticated sequences without drawing or "wiring" icons together.
Instead, application builders simply use the computer's mouse to
"drag-and-drop" the icons for the graphs, displays, data entry fields, and
other interactive components (or objects) needed to build the test
sequence.

Although TestPoint eliminates the need for conventional programming when
developing most applications, it also offers wide flexibility, providing
full access to external subroutines written using conventional languages
such as C, Visual C++ and Turbo Pascal for Windows. Any language that can
create a Windows DLL can be used.

The package is designed to run on IBM compatible AT, 386, or 486 computers
utilizing Microsoft Windows 3.1 or later. Applications created using
TestPoint may be distributed freely without paying an additional license
fee.
